Major Jonathan Cooper has been an officer in The Salvation Army for 16 years, serving in two corps appointments before spending the last seven years in youth and candidate ministry as a Divisional Youth & Candidates Secretary in both the Eastern Michigan and Great Lakes Divisions. He will be the new business member from Salvation Army.
 
A sixth-generation Salvationist from St. Louis, Missouri, Jonathan first connected with his wife, Chrissy, at camp as kids. Together, they have served faithfully in ministry while raising four children, ages 19, 15, 13, and 11. As a family, they value time together and encourage one another’s unique interests and talents – from motorcycles to theatre, lacrosse, and gaming.
 
Jonathan holds a Master’s Degree in Organizational Leadership and a Bachelor’s Degree in Ministry. He is passionate about equipping and discipling leaders, and his love for music, sports, and quality time with family enriches both his ministry and leadership.
 
A former member of the Indianapolis Downtown Rotary Club, Jonathan is thrilled to once again be part of Rotary—especially in a club known for its transformative work and strong service mindset. He is eager to roll up his sleeves, build meaningful relationships, and join fellow Suburban Rotary members in making a lasting difference in the community.
